Dead Coin Battery

A dead coin battery is the most common reason of a key fob that isn't locking or unlocking the doors. It is also the simplest to fix as it can be replaced in several minutes. You should use a brand new coin battery with the same size, voltage, and specifications as the original to avoid a faulty battery. Also, do not use batteries that have been exposed to clean water (rain, clean tap water, or even soda) since this can cause damage to the internal chip. Water Damage

If you accidentally dropped your Rolls Royce Dawn key fob in the sink or left it sitting in the rain, it is likely to be suffering from water damage. Although the electronic chip inside is protected by rubber seals prolonged exposure to clean tap water or even salty ocean water could cause it to stop working properly.

Over time water can cause corrosion, which results in malfunctioning circuitry that could cause problems with the vehicle's security and ignition systems. It also can interfere with signal transmission, causing the remote keyless system to fail. The key fob may lock your car or activate the immobiliser, leaving you stranded.

To avoid this, remove the key fob from its case and wipe it clean with a the help of a damp towel to get rid of any moisture. You can also place the key in a bag with uncooked silica gel or rice to absorb any moisture. Once the key has dried, it should function normally again. Dead 12 Volt Battery

The 12 volt battery inside your rolls royce key unboxing Royce Dawn is responsible to provide high electrical current, not only for starting the engine but also to provide power to all accessories and on-board computers. This battery will not work when it is not working or if the flow of electricity is interrupted by corrosion on the terminals of the battery or the ground connection.

To determine the condition of your Dawn battery it is possible to conduct a conductivity test with a multimeter. To accomplish this you must disconnect the negative cable from the battery, and then touch one probe of the multimeter to the ground wire of the battery, and the other probe to any exposed metal component of your vehicle's engine, chassis or body. The reading should be zero ohms or close to it.

If the results aren't satisfactory You can replace the battery with a new one with the same voltage, size and specification. Make sure that the replacement is fully charged prior to use it. The most common cause of an unsatisfactory battery is internal degeneration caused by the aging process however it could be caused by parasitic draw, or if the car is in a garage for a long period of time.
